About 9b

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

9b is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Hucknall, Nottingham, Nottingham (NG15 7AE). It has a recorded floor area of 105 m² (around 1130 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(April 2022) shows an E (score 44),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The rating has held steady at E across 2 certificates since July 2009. Between certificates, lighting went from Good to Very Good; while window efficiency dropped from Good to Average and hot-water efficiency dropped from Average to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 80), a 2-band jump. Other recorded features include a basement.

Last sale on file: £164,000 in October 2022.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end. At 105 m² it's 18% larger than the typical home in the postcode (89 m² median across 54 EPCs). Across 2009–2022,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.4%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£145/sq ft) was about 103.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
